Overview: The recent Beltrami County Board of Commissioners meeting focused on the Sanford Center, with a detailed presentation from Bobby Anderson, the center’s general manager. Anderson outlined the challenges and strategies for improving community engagement and financial stability for the facility. Despite reporting a net loss of $359,000 last year, Anderson emphasized that this was the second-best financial performance in the center’s history. He attributed the losses partly to staffing challenges that affected performance in 2023 but remained optimistic about improvements in 2024. Anderson underscored the importance of local involvement in managing the center, advocating for the Bemidji community’s deeper integration into the facility’s operations.

Overview: During the recent Becker County Board of Commissioners meeting, housing challenges and financial pressures took center stage. The Board discussed various housing-related issues, notably the need for affordable housing and the constraints faced by individuals seeking housing assistance. With 45 individuals on the waiting list for the housing choice voucher program and properties like Maple Hills and Frzy consistently full, the need for more housing options is evident. Renovation plans are underway for existing properties, such as new siding, windows, and decks, with an RFP in progress. The West River Town Homes experienced a vacancy, which was quickly filled. Meanwhile, the Economic Development Authority is expected to review a new screening process for childcare grants, reflecting ongoing efforts to address community needs.
